How they compare
Montenegro currently reports 10.18 million kg against 8.24 million kg in Brunei Darussalam, a difference of 1.94 million kg.
That makes Montenegro's figure about 1.2 times Brunei Darussalam's.
Across all 18 years both countries report, Montenegro has been ahead every year.
Brunei Darussalam ranks 159th and Montenegro ranks 155th of 195 countries.
Montenegro has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
The Livestock Manure domain of FAOSTAT contains estimates of nitrogen (N) inputs to agricultural soils from livestock manure. Data on the N losses to air and water are also disseminated. These estimates are compiled using official FAOSTAT statistics of animal stocks and by applying the internationally approved Guidelines of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C). Data are available by country, with global coverage and updated annually.The following elements are disseminated: 1) Stocks; 2) Amount excreted in manure (N content); 3) Manure left on pasture (N content); 4) Manure left on pasture that volatilises (N content); 5) Manure left on pasture that leaches (N content); 6) Manure treated (N content); 7) Losses from manure treated (N content); 8) Manure applied to soils (N content); 9) Manure applied to soils that volatilises (N content); 10) Manure applied to soils that leaches (N content).
